Practice and Preparation Tips

Effective preparation requires consistent effort and rigorous practice. Here are some tips to enhance your preparation:

Timed Practice: Consistently practice within the exam’s timeframe to get used to the pressure and manage time effectively. Previous Year Papers: Utilize previous year’s question papers to understand the pattern and difficulty level. Mock Tests: Enroll in online mock test series to gauge your performance and identify weak areas. Group Study: Participating in study groups can provide additional support and motivation. Regular Review: Regularly review your answers and learn from mistakes. Critical Focus: Focus on critical areas that are expected to have more weightage in the exam.
